How To Choose The Best Collagen and Biotin Supplements for Women
Choosing a collagen and biotin supplement is less about finding a magic pill and more about matching a format to your habits and knowing which added ingredients do what. The right choice is one you can take consistently without dreading it.
Form Factor: Powder vs. Gummies vs. Tablets
Powders are the most common and typically offer the highest dose per serving, like the 11g in the Micro Ingredients formula. Gummies are a convenient, tasty alternative for those who dislike the texture of powders, though they often have a lower collagen dose per serving. Tablets, like Viviscal, are the most straightforward for travel but usually contain less collagen and more of a targeted nutrient blend.
Hydrolyzed Collagen Is the Key
Look for the word “hydrolyzed” on the label. This means the collagen has been broken down into smaller peptides, which makes it easier for your body to absorb. Most of the powders here, including ZEBORA and DRFOSTER, use this form for better solubility and bioavailability.
Collagen Types and What They Target
Collagen is not a single protein. Type I is the most abundant and is primarily for skin, hair, and nails. Type II is associated with joint health. A “multi-collagen” powder containing Types I, II, III, V, and X gives you a spectrum of benefits from skin to joints to gut, which is why these formulas are popular for overall wellness.

Understanding the Specs
Hydrolyzed Collagen Peptides
This is the form of collagen that has been broken down into smaller particles so your body can absorb it more easily. When a label says “hydrolyzed,” it means the collagen is already partially digested, making it more effective than non-hydrolyzed forms.
Collagen Types (I, II, III, V, X)
Different types of collagen serve different purposes. Type I is the most abundant and mainly supports skin, hair, and nails. Type II is best known for joint health. Multi-collagen blends that include types V and X offer broader coverage for the whole body.
Biotin (mg/mcg) and Hyaluronic Acid
Biotin is a B-vitamin that supports keratin production, which is what makes hair and nails strong. Hyaluronic acid is a molecule that attracts and holds water, so it helps keep skin plump and hydrated. Higher amounts, like 5,000 mcg of biotin, are common in beauty-oriented formulas.
Probiotics and CFUs
Some collagen powders add probiotics — beneficial bacteria measured in CFUs (colony-forming units) — to support digestion and gut health. This can improve nutrient absorption and reduce bloating, making it a two-in-one supplement for women who want beauty and digestive benefits together.
